Codeine is a pain-relieving opioid drug with added antitussive and antidiarrheal activity. It is a natural plant alkaloid found in opium extracts. It is derived from Papaver somniferum (poppy plant). It is used to treat moderate to severe pain and cough in people above 18 years of age. Adverse effects include stomach pain, headache, difficult urination, etc. Sudden stopping of the drug after long-term use causes withdrawal symptoms.
